Climate in Laredo (Texas)


Average weather, temperature, rainfall, sunshine hours

The climate of Laredo is sub-tropical semi-arid, with a very mild winter and a very hot, muggy summer.
The city is located in southern Texas. Beyond the Rio Grande River is the Mexican city of Nuevo Laredo.
We are on the 27th parallel, not far from the Tropic, and indeed the hot season is very long.
The average temperature of the coldest month (January) is of 14.2 °C (58 °F), that of the warmest month (August) is of 31.7 °C (89 °F).
Precipitation amounts to 500 millimeters (19.7 inches) per year.

Laredo

The winter, from December to February, is very mild, though with sudden changes in temperature.
The sun shines quite often, although there are periods characterized by clouds, rain and wind.
There may be hot periods even in the middle of winter, with highs around 30 °C (86 °F).
However, there may also be short cold periods, with highs below 10 °C (50 °F).
On the coldest days of the year, the temperature typically drops just below freezing, but once every few years there can be more intense cold spells. The record is -9.5 °C (15 °F), recorded in December 1989. In December 1983 and February 2021, the temperature dropped to -8 °C (17.5).
Very rarely, as happened on Christmas 2004 and in December 2017, it can even snow.

The summer, from June to September, is very hot and quite sunny, although sometimes a thunderstorm can break out. There are long periods, sometimes whole months, with maximum temperatures around 40 °C (104 °F). It is often very hot even in May and October, and sometimes in late April. We are in the hottest part of Texas. The record is 45 °C (113 °F), recorded in June and in July 1998.

From time to time, the city can be reached by the remnants of a hurricane, coming from the Gulf of Mexico or the Pacific. In general, hurricanes weaken when they penetrate inland, however, they can still bring abundant rains. The hurricane season runs from June to November, although they are more likely from August to October, with a peak in September.

Best Time


The best time to visit Laredo is from November to March. Winter, from December to February, is generally a mild season, although it can sometimes get cold (especially in December and January). You can therefore choose the months of March and November.

Laredo - Climate data


In Laredo, the average temperature of the coldest month (January) is of 14.2 °C, that of the warmest month (August) is of 31.7 °C. Here are the average temperatures.
Laredo - Average temperatures (1991-2020)
Temperatures (°C)
MonthMinMaxMean
January8.220.214.2
February10.923.317.1
March14.627.120.9
April18.331.324.8
May21.934.528.2
June24.637.230.9
July25.137.931.5
August25.238.231.7
September22.834.528.7
October18.830.624.7
November13.124.718.9
December8.920.514.7
Year17.73023.85

Precipitation amounts to 500 millimeters per year: it is therefore quite scarce. It ranges from 15 millimeters in the driest month (February) to 100 millimeters in the wettest one (September). Here is the average precipitation.

Laredo - Weather by month

Based on the period 1991-2020
(January - February - March - April - May - June - July - August - September - October - November - December)


January, the coldest month of the year, is generally a mild month. The average temperature is of 14.2 °C, with a minimum of 8.2 °C and a maximum of 20.2 °C.
Cold thermometer iconOn the coldest nights of the month, the temperature usually drops to around 0.5 °C. However, it dropped to -3.9 °C in January 2017.
Warm thermometer iconOn the warmest days of the month, the temperature usually reaches around 30 °C. However, it reached 34.4 °C in January 2013.
Rain iconPrecipitation amounts to 20 mm, distributed over 5 days.
The day lasts on average 10 hours and 35 minutes.
Sun iconThere are on average 4.5 hours of sunshine per day. So, the sun shines 43% of the time.
The average humidity is 62%.
The average wind speed is of 14.2 kph.


February is generally a very mild month. The average temperature is of 17.1 °C, with a minimum of 10.9 °C and a maximum of 23.3 °C.
Cold thermometer iconOn the coldest nights of the month, the temperature usually drops to around 2.5 °C. However, it dropped to -4 °C in February 2011.
Warm thermometer iconOn the warmest days of the month, the temperature usually reaches around 32.5 °C. However, it reached 39.4 °C in February 2011.
Rain iconPrecipitation amounts to 15 mm, distributed over 5 days.
The day lasts on average 11 hours and 20 minutes.
Sun iconThere are on average 5.5 hours of sunshine per day. So, the sun shines 50% of the time.
The average humidity is 60%.
The average wind speed is of 15.4 kph.


March is generally a warm month. The average temperature is of 20.9 °C, with a minimum of 14.6 °C and a maximum of 27.1 °C.
Cold thermometer iconOn the coldest nights of the month, the temperature usually drops to around 5 °C. However, it dropped to -0.6 °C in March 1996.
Warm thermometer iconOn the warmest days of the month, the temperature usually reaches around 35.5 °C. However, it reached 40.5 °C in March 2008.
Rain iconPrecipitation amounts to 35 mm, distributed over 5 days.
The day lasts on average 12 hours and 0 minutes.
Sun iconThere are on average 6 hours of sunshine per day. So, the sun shines 51% of the time.
The average humidity is 57%.
The average wind speed is of 17.9 kph.


April is generally a warm to hot month. The average temperature is of 24.8 °C, with a minimum of 18.3 °C and a maximum of 31.3 °C.
Cold thermometer iconOn the coldest nights of the month, the temperature usually drops to around 10 °C. However, it dropped to 4 °C in April 2007.
Warm thermometer iconOn the warmest days of the month, the temperature usually reaches around 38.5 °C. However, it reached 43.8 °C in April 2011.
Rain iconPrecipitation amounts to 35 mm, distributed over 4 days.
The day lasts on average 12 hours and 55 minutes.
Sun iconThere are on average 6.5 hours of sunshine per day. So, the sun shines 49% of the time.
The average humidity is 55%.
The average wind speed is of 19.1 kph.


May is generally a very hot month. The average temperature is of 28.2 °C, with a minimum of 21.9 °C and a maximum of 34.5 °C.
Cold thermometer iconOn the coldest nights of the month, the temperature usually drops to around 16 °C. However, it dropped to 11.1 °C in May 2015.
Warm thermometer iconOn the warmest days of the month, the temperature usually reaches around 40 °C. However, it reached 44.4 °C in May 2011.
Rain iconPrecipitation amounts to 70 mm, distributed over 5 days.
The day lasts on average 13 hours and 30 minutes.
Sun iconThere are on average 6.5 hours of sunshine per day. So, the sun shines 49% of the time.
The average humidity is 59%.
The average wind speed is of 19.9 kph.


June is generally a very hot month. The average temperature is of 30.9 °C, with a minimum of 24.6 °C and a maximum of 37.2 °C.
Cold thermometer iconOn the coldest nights of the month, the temperature usually drops to around 21 °C. However, it dropped to 18.3 °C in June 2015.
Warm thermometer iconOn the warmest days of the month, the temperature usually reaches around 41 °C. However, it reached 45 °C in June 1998.
Rain iconPrecipitation amounts to 45 mm, distributed over 5 days.
The day lasts on average 13 hours and 55 minutes. June 21, the summer solstice, is the longest day of the year in the Northern Hemisphere.
Sun iconThere are on average 8.5 hours of sunshine per day. So, the sun shines 62% of the time.
The average humidity is 56%.
The average wind speed is of 20.4 kph.


July is generally a very hot month. The average temperature is of 31.5 °C, with a minimum of 25.1 °C and a maximum of 37.9 °C.
Cold thermometer iconOn the coldest nights of the month, the temperature usually drops to around 22.5 °C. However, it dropped to 20 °C in July 2019.
Warm thermometer iconOn the warmest days of the month, the temperature usually reaches around 41 °C. However, it reached 44.9 °C in July 1998.
Rain iconPrecipitation amounts to 45 mm, distributed over 4 days.
The day lasts on average 13 hours and 40 minutes.
Sun iconThere are on average 9 hours of sunshine per day. So, the sun shines 67% of the time.
The average humidity is 55%.
The average wind speed is of 20.7 kph.


August, the hottest month of the year, is generally a very hot month. However, there are remarkable differences between night and day. The average temperature is of 31.7 °C, with a minimum of 25.2 °C and a maximum of 38.2 °C.
Cold thermometer iconOn the coldest nights of the month, the temperature usually drops to around 22.5 °C. However, it dropped to 20 °C in August 1992.
Warm thermometer iconOn the warmest days of the month, the temperature usually reaches around 41 °C. However, it reached 43.3 °C in August 2009.
Rain iconPrecipitation amounts to 40 mm, distributed over 4 days.
The day lasts on average 13 hours and 5 minutes.
Sun iconThere are on average 8.5 hours of sunshine per day. So, the sun shines 66% of the time.
The average humidity is 54%.
The average wind speed is of 18.8 kph.


September is generally a very hot month. The average temperature is of 28.7 °C, with a minimum of 22.8 °C and a maximum of 34.5 °C.
Cold thermometer iconOn the coldest nights of the month, the temperature usually drops to around 17 °C. However, it dropped to 11.6 °C in September 1995.
Warm thermometer iconOn the warmest days of the month, the temperature usually reaches around 39 °C. However, it reached 43.6 °C in September 2000.
Rain iconPrecipitation amounts to 100 mm, distributed over 8 days.
The day lasts on average 12 hours and 20 minutes.
Sun iconThere are on average 7 hours of sunshine per day. So, the sun shines 58% of the time.
The average humidity is 62%.
The average wind speed is of 15.2 kph.


October is generally a warm to hot month. The average temperature is of 24.7 °C, with a minimum of 18.8 °C and a maximum of 30.6 °C.
Cold thermometer iconOn the coldest nights of the month, the temperature usually drops to around 8.5 °C. However, it dropped to 1.6 °C in October 1993.
Warm thermometer iconOn the warmest days of the month, the temperature usually reaches around 36.5 °C. However, it reached 39.4 °C in October 2012.
Rain iconPrecipitation amounts to 40 mm, distributed over 4 days.
The day lasts on average 11 hours and 30 minutes.
Sun iconThere are on average 6.5 hours of sunshine per day. So, the sun shines 55% of the time.
The average humidity is 60%.
The average wind speed is of 15.5 kph.


November is generally a warm month. The average temperature is of 18.9 °C, with a minimum of 13.1 °C and a maximum of 24.7 °C.
Cold thermometer iconOn the coldest nights of the month, the temperature usually drops to around 4 °C. However, it dropped to -1.7 °C in November 1993.
Warm thermometer iconOn the warmest days of the month, the temperature usually reaches around 32.5 °C. However, it reached 35 °C in November 2010.
Rain iconPrecipitation amounts to 25 mm, distributed over 4 days.
The day lasts on average 10 hours and 50 minutes.
Sun iconThere are on average 5.5 hours of sunshine per day. So, the sun shines 49% of the time.
The average humidity is 62%.
The average wind speed is of 14.6 kph.


December is generally a very mild month. The average temperature is of 14.7 °C, with a minimum of 8.9 °C and a maximum of 20.5 °C.
Cold thermometer iconOn the coldest nights of the month, the temperature usually drops to around 0.5 °C. However, it dropped to -5.2 °C in December 1997.
Warm thermometer iconOn the warmest days of the month, the temperature usually reaches around 30 °C. However, it reached 35 °C in December 2019.
Rain iconPrecipitation amounts to 25 mm, distributed over 6 days.
The day lasts on average 10 hours and 25 minutes. December 21, the winter solstice, is the shortest day of the year in the Northern Hemisphere.
Sun iconThere are on average 4.5 hours of sunshine per day. So, the sun shines 43% of the time.
The average humidity is 63%.
The average wind speed is of 13.8 kph.
